''WWIII'' follows the common KMFDM practice of naming albums, and many songs, with five Symbols . The album is considerably more political than Attak or MDFMK 's single release. The songs primarily attack George W. Bush 's Presidency, various US wars in the Middle East, and America's foreign policy. The last track, "Intro", introduces the members of the band.
